First off – what is a barrel nut? A barrel nut is a type of fastener that’s cylindrical in shape with threads on the inside. These are commonly used to attach metal parts together or mount objects onto surfaces such as wood or walls. Some other names for this kind of fastener include cross dowel nuts, connector bolts, or Chicago screws.

Types of Barrel Nuts
There are primarily three types of barrel nuts available today: zinc-plated, stainless steel and brass.

– Zinc plated – These are rust-resistant and easy-to-use options; they come in different sizes suitable for various applications.
– Stainless steel – More expensive than their zinc-plated counterparts but they offer better anti-corrosion properties making it an ideal choice if you’re working with outdoor furniture.
– Brass – Known for its durability, brass connectors will always give your piece more vintage appeal thanks to Goldish-brown colouration
